body {background-color:#D4D4D4}


 Polices et tailles 
p {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	line-height: 12px;
}

.p10 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
}
.p11 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	line-height: 12px;
}
.p12 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 16px;
}
.p13 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	line-height: 17px;
}
.p14 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	line-height: 17px;
}
.p16 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	line-height: 17px;
}


 Couleurs 
.blanc {color: #FFFFFF}
.gris {color: #C5C5C5}
.grisfonce {color: #666666;}
.turquoise {color: #05AEFE}
.vert {color: #BBE624;}


 Liens 
a{color: #99CC00; text-decoration: none;}
a:hover{color: #85B000; text-decoration: underline;}


 Formulaires 
TEXTAREA {color: #000000; background-color: #E4EEF8; text-align:justify; font-family:verdana, Arial, Helvetica, sans-serif; font-weight: 100;  font-size: 11px; border: 1 solid #295D94}
INPUT.validation {color: #ffffff; background-color: #295D94; text-align:center; font-family:arial, verdana, sans-serif; font-size: 10px; border: 1 solid #000000}
INPUT.champ {color: #000000; background-color: #E4EEF8; text-align:justify; font-family:verdana, sans-serif; font-weight: 100;  font-size: 11px; border: 1 solid #295D94 }
INPUT.checkbox {color: #000000; background-color: #E4EEF8; text-align:justify; font-family:verdana, sans-serif; font-weight: 100;  font-size: 10px; border: 1 solid #295D94 }
SELECT {color: #000000; background-color: #E4EEF8; text-align:justify; font-family:verdana,sans-serif; font-weight: 100;  font-size: 10px; border: 1 solid #295D94}


 Positionnement div 
div.position1_1 {position:absolute; left: 0px; top: 84px;}
div.position1_2 {position:absolute;left: 193px; top: 84px;}
div.position1_3 {position:absolute; left: 495px; top: 84px;}
div.position1_4 {position:absolute; left: 796px; top: 84px;}
div.position2_1 {position:absolute; left: 0px; top: 247px;}
div.position2_2 {position:absolute; left: 193px; top: 247px;}
div.position2_3 {position:absolute; left: 495px; top: 247px;}
div.position2_4 {position:absolute; left: 796px; top: 247px;}
div.position3_1 {position:absolute; left: 0px; top: 410px;}
div.position3_2 {position:absolute; left: 193px; top: 410px;}
div.position3_3 {position:absolute; left: 495px; top: 410px;}
div.position3_4 {position:absolute; left: 796px; top: 410px;}
div.position4_1 {position:absolute; left: 0px; top: 573px;}
div.position4_2 {position:absolute; left: 193px; top: 573px;}
div.position4_3 {position:absolute; left: 495px; top: 573px;}
div.position4_4 {position:absolute; left: 796px; top: 573px;}


#contenu_rub {
	position:absolute;
	left: 30px;
	top: 128px;
	width:605px;
	height:307px;
	z-index: 0;
}

#contenu_rub.noir {
	position:absolute;
	left: 30px;
	top: 128px;
	width:605px;
	height:307px;
	z-index: 0;
	background-color: #000000;	
}

#logo {	position:absolute; left: 27px; top: 16px; z-index: 1; }

#azur {
	position:absolute;
	left: 478px;
	top: 19px;
	z-index: 1;
	width: 455px;
}

#etapes {
	position:absolute;
	left: 30px;
	top: 126px;
	width:605px;
	height:303px;
	z-index: 0;
	visibility: visible;
}



#ambition {
	position:absolute;
	left: 635px;
	top: 128px;
	width:333px;
	height:326px;
	overflow: scroll;
	z-index: 1;
	visibility: visible;
}


#agencepilote {
	position:absolute;
	left: 30px;	
	top: 453px;
	width:330px;
	height:160px;
	z-index: 1;
}



#espacefranchise {
	position:absolute;
	left: 360px;	top: 453px;
	width:275px;
	height:160px;
	z-index: 1;
	visibility: visible;
}



#espacepresse {
	position:absolute;
	left: 635px;	
	top: 453px;
	width:333px;
	height:160px;
	z-index: 10;
	background-color: #000000;	
	visibility: visible;
}


#prendrerdv {
	position:absolute;
	left: 635px;	
	top: 453px;
	width:333px;
	height:160px;
	z-index: 1;
	visibility: hidden;
}

#bottom {
	position:absolute;
	left: 30px;
	top: 615px;
	width:938px;
	height:60px;
	background-color:#000000;
	z-index: 1;
}
.formulaire {
	position:absolute;
	left: 30px;
	top: 126px;
	width:605px;
	height:307px;
	z-index: 10;
	visibility: hidden;
	background-color: #000000;	
}

